gigabytes
- Definition: A gigabyte (GB) is a unit of digital information storage that is commonly used to quantify data size. It is equivalent to 1,024 megabytes.
- Symbol: The symbol for gigabyte is “GB.”
- Usage: Gigabytes are often used to measure the storage capacity of devices such as hard drives, USB flash drives, and memory cards, as well as the size of files and data transfers.
megabytes
- Definition: A megabyte (MB) is a unit of digital information storage that is equal to 1,024 kilobytes (KB). It is often used to describe the size of smaller files.
- Symbol: The symbol for megabyte is “MB.”
- Usage: Megabytes are commonly used for measuring file sizes, such as images, documents, and audio files, as well as data transfer sizes over the internet.
Origin of the gigabytes
- The term “gigabyte” originated from the prefix “giga,” which comes from the Greek word “gigas,” meaning “giant.” The term was first used in the context of computer science in the 1980s as data storage and processing needs expanded.
Origin of the megabytes
- The term “megabyte” is derived from the prefix “mega,” which comes from the Greek word “megas,” meaning “great.” It was introduced in the early days of computing to describe larger data storage capacities, specifically in the late 1960s to early 1970s.
gigabytes to megabytes Conversion
Conversion Table:
GB | MB |
1 GB | 1,024 MB |
2 GB | 2,048 MB |
3 GB | 3,072 MB |
4 GB | 4,096 MB |
5 GB | 5,120 MB |
